Sony recently extended friends list capacity from 50 to 100 friends which was a great move and sorely needed for some of us. Somewhere along the way though, they broke something about adding friends. Just to be clear, I’m running firmware 2.41, but when someone sends me a friend request, I get an email in my inbox. I click on it and choose “Accept” to add them, then I get an error message to the effect of “Sorry, this friend request has been canceled.”
At first I thought I had a lot of really finnicky people wanting to be my friends. I wondered if they could truly be so impatient that if I didn’t accept within the hour, they were giving up on me and canceling the friend request. That’s enough to give a guy a complex… having people second-guess whether they want to be associated with you… in numbers!
Then I happened to scroll to the bottom of my friends list and I saw all the people I’d thought canceled their friend requests, listed in white, waiting on me to do something. I highlight one of them, push triangle, and then I could accept the request and this time it worked. I added like 8 people like that. Now, whenever I get a friend request, I still attempt to accept it as intended and it doesn’t work, so I go down and accept this the half-assed way and that works. This is broken Sony, fix it.
